  • Patent number: 5343725
    Abstract: An improved tube rotary draw bending apparatus for bending a tube having a bend die around which a bend in the tube is formed, a pressure die and means for maintaining a pre-programmed frictional profile of the interaction of the tube with the pressure die during the bending operation. Improved quality of the bent tube is consistently obtained.

  • Patent number: 5308587
    Abstract: Apparatus and process for the production of gaseous sulphur dioxide mixture for conversion to sulphur trioxide in a catalytic converter in the production of sulphuric acid by the contact process. Apparatus comprises the furnace to produce sulphur dioxide gas from elemental sulphur and a first dry air stream; means for feeding a first portion of the sulphur dioxide gas to a waste heat boiler to cool the gas; the improvement comprising combining a second portion of the sulphur dioxide gas exiting the furnace with a second dry air stream to provide a combined gaseous stream which bypasses the boiler and subsequently is combined with the cooled sulphur dioxide stream. The system provides use of a bypass valve which experiences only cooled sulphur dioxide containing gases with its attendant reduced corrosion. Further, the system may operate at higher temperatures than is common to provide further advantages.

  • Patent number: 5277247
    Abstract: A heat exchanger for exchanging heat between fluids comprising a shell and five tube bundles laid out as to collectively form a series of concentric pentagons, wherein each adjacent pair of tube bundles define an angle of 108.degree. and extend longitudinally within said shell and define a central space between them, said central space also extending longitudinally in said shell and being parallel to said tubes; each tube bundle consisting of a plurality of longitudinally extending parallel tubes in end view laid out in a set of parallel lines wherein each tube on a first parallel line with the two nearest tubes each on a second line adjacent to said first line forms an isosceles triangle having one angle of 72.degree. and two angles each of 54.degree.. This allows simple heat exchanger tube layout which is easy to fabricate and provide a compact tube bundle. The tube layout utilizes core tube entry of fluids and can accommodate internal core tubes or bypasses to cope with differential expansion.

  • Patent number: 5237936
    Abstract: A pallet having a front, a back and two sides; each of said sides having a fork entry opening, open at both ends of the pallet and along the length of each side; each opening having a stepped upper surface comprising a lower portion for engagement by an upper surface of a fork to lift the pallet and an outer upper portion extending from the inner portion to the side spaced upwardly from the inner portion. The pallet can be used with pallet trucks that have a wider inter-fork distance wider than the width of the pallet to permit adjacent intimate abuttment of similar pallets in a series to provide maximum use of shop floor space and pallet platform stocking area.
